Other internal session save handlers are provided by php extensions such as sqlite as sqlite, memcache as memcache, and memcached as memcached. Examples are devrandom or devurandom which are available on many unix systems. Sessionhandlerinterface is an interface which defines a prototype for creating a custom session handler. Save handlers themselves are decoupled from php s save handler functions and are only implemented as a php save handler when utilized in conjunction with zend\session \sessionmanager. Complete overview of the php sessionhandler lifecycle github. This is most useful when a storage method other than those supplied by php sessions is preferred, e. I have the session handler running fine when the php. Destroying the session manually is essential especially when using. By default, this class will wrap whatever internal save handler is set as. For example, you may destroy session data when a user logs out and it. I am developing a site that needs to store sessions in a mysql db. Argument 1 is not a valid callback the callbacks can be defined in any way that php allows, so they could be straight functions, closures, object methods, or. Phps default session handling behavior can provide all you need in most cases, but there.
1245 959 193 773 109 71 385 736 1067 738 620 1365 482 1278 1242 1249 1071 383 766 1401 236 346 674 1174 873 797 76 1361 132 472 547 76 796 1297 345 275 65 583 1304 129 1367 423 241